如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

Homebrew下载与安装:Mac用户必备的包管理工具

Homebrew下载与安装:Mac用户必备的包管理工具

如果你是一名Mac用户,那么你一定听说过Homebrew,这款强大的包管理工具可以让你的Mac系统变得更加高效和便捷。今天,我们就来详细介绍一下Homebrew下载与安装的过程,以及它的一些常见应用。

什么是Homebrew?

Homebrew是一个免费且开源的软件包管理系统,专门为macOS设计。它允许用户通过命令行轻松安装、更新和卸载软件包。Homebrew的设计理念是“为Mac用户提供一个更好的包管理体验”,它可以帮助你管理那些苹果官方商店(App Store)没有提供的软件。

Homebrew下载与安装

  1. 安装Xcode命令行工具: 在安装Homebrew之前,你需要确保你的Mac已经安装了Xcode命令行工具。可以通过以下命令来安装:

    xcode-select --install
  2. 下载并安装Homebrew: 打开终端(Terminal),然后输入以下命令:

    /b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"

    这个命令会自动下载并安装Homebrew。安装过程中可能会提示你输入管理员密码,请按照提示操作。

  3. 验证安装: 安装完成后,可以通过以下命令来验证Homebrew是否安装成功:

    brew --version

    如果返回了版本号,说明Homebrew已经成功安装。

Homebrew的基本使用

  • 安装软件包: 使用brew install命令可以安装软件包。例如,安装Git:

    brew install git
  • 更新Homebrew: 保持Homebrew的更新可以确保你能获取到最新的软件包:

    brew update
  • 升级已安装的软件包

    brew upgrade
  • 卸载软件包

    brew uninstall [软件包名]

Homebrew的常见应用

  1. 开发工具

    • Git:版本控制系统。
    • Node.js:JavaScript运行时。
    • Python:编程语言。
    • Ruby:编程语言。
  2. 系统工具

    • wget:用于从网络下载文件。
    • htop:更好的系统监控工具。
    • tree:以树状结构显示目录内容。
  3. 数据库

    • MySQL:关系型数据库管理系统。
    • PostgreSQL:对象关系型数据库系统。
  4. 其他实用工具

    • ffmpeg:处理视频和音频的工具。
    • imagemagick:图像处理工具。
    • mas:管理Mac App Store应用。

注意事项

  • 安全性:虽然Homebrew本身是安全的,但安装软件包时请确保来源可靠,避免安装未知或不信任的软件。

  • 依赖管理:Homebrew会自动处理软件包的依赖关系,但有时可能会遇到冲突或问题,建议定期清理不必要的依赖:

    brew cleanup
  • 更新频率:Homebrew的软件包更新频繁,建议定期更新以保持系统的稳定性和安全性。

总结

Homebrew为Mac用户提供了一个便捷的途径来管理和安装各种软件包,无论你是开发者还是普通用户,都能从中受益。通过简单的命令行操作,你可以轻松地管理你的软件环境,提高工作效率。希望这篇文章能帮助你更好地理解和使用Homebrew下载与安装,并在日常使用中发挥其最大价值。